Video: History of underwear

Sometimes we all just need a good history lesson to brighten our day. Here, Kristina Haugland, Associate Curator of Costume and Textiles at the Philadelphia Museum of Art, discusses the subject of undergarment history for your edification (with marvelous slides). It’s about an hour and a half long. I found it engaging and very well done – do let me know what you think of it.
